By chatting and you may bringing private facts, you know and you will invest in our Terms of use and you may Privacy Coverage. The newest synonyms acquit and you will vindicate are occasionally compatible, but acquit implies a proper choice within the one’s prefer in respect so you can a definite fees. Exonerate indicates a complete clearance out of a keen accusation or fees and you may from people attendant suspicion away from blame otherwise shame.